Default access point question


Hi

Is a computer that is used for others on the network to connect to the
internet classed as an access point?

Default Re: access point question
geepeetee wrote:

> Hi
>
> Is a computer that is used for others on the network to connect to the
> internet classed as an access point?


No. It's a gateway. With Windows ICS, it's sometimes called the host
computer.
